Oakbug Milk Cap is the common name for Lactarius quietus, a milk-cap fungus associated particularly with oak trees. Its common name refers to the odour, often compared with the smell of bugs, that can become noticeable when the flesh or gills are bruised. The species produces gills that exude latex...
